The Atlanta Braves announced on Wednesday the launch of Braves TV, a streaming service that is expected to air over 140 games during the team’s upcoming 2026 season.

The service will offer live game coverage, pre- and post-game coverage and on-demand game replays.

Broadcasts will be available on web, mobile and connected devices; on platforms including iOS, Android, Apple TV, Amazon Fire, Roku, Chromecast, PlayStation and Xbox; and on Samsung, LG and Android smart TVs.
